Automotive Industry Analysis
The automotive industry plays an important role in maintaining the economic health of European countries. The turnover generated by the industry accounts for almost 7% of the EU’s GDP. Business Challenges Faced
The client – a leading original equipment manufacturer (OEM) in the automotive industry – wanted to identify potential opportunities and risks in the supply chain amid wrenching changes in global economies. They wanted to gain in-depth insights into the supply trends impacting operations in the European market. The client, therefore, approached SpendEdge to leverage its expertise in offering supply side risk assessment solutions to better understand the current structure of the supply chain and devise effective supply chain strategies.Â
Key objectives the client aimed to achieve through this supply side risk assessment were:Â Â
- Mitigate chances of supply failure occurring due to supplier or logistics delays.
- Reduce the possibilities of out turn costs being higher than the anticipated costs.
- Minimize risks associated with quality failure, product failure, and latent defects impacting auto sales growth.

As a part of supply side risk assessment, the experts at SpendEdge identified potential risks associated with the supply chain. They assessed each risk and predicted the likelihood of risks being realized and the severity of the impact. Also, they analyzed factors such as ongoing austerity economics, environmental concerns, and new technological advances influencing profitability across the supply chain to develop a robust contingency plan.
With SpendEdge’s supply side risk assessment solutions, the client was able to identify risks related to manufacturing, logistics, and inventory. This helped the client to develop an effective contingency plan and invest in local skills and resources while ensuring quality. Also, the OEM was able to streamline operations from component supply for manufacture to vehicle delivery.
Within six weeks, the OEM in the automotive industry was able to gain an in-depth understanding of all network flows and supply chain processes across the organization to re-engineer and develop an optimized supply chain.
